iOS 26 regression: `DeviceActivityEvent`: `eventDidReachThreshold` called immediately (instead of waiting till threshold is reached)
Hello! I am experiencing some strange bugs around DeviceActivityEvents: When creating a DeviceActivityEvent we can assign a threshold and applicationTokens. The idea is, that after the user has spent said threshold on said apps, eventDidReachThreshold is called. includesPastActivity is set to false. On iOS 26 however, it happens (quite reliably after updating to a new beta seed) quite often that eventDidReachThreshold is called immediately (after a couple of seconds) instead of waiting for the threshold to be met. Is anyone else seeing similar issues on iOS 26? Only workaround I have found is to ask users to re-grant Screen Time permissions. This only holds for about two weeks though or at most until the next iOS 26 beta update is installed. Feedback filed under: FB18061981 FB18927456

Icon Composer: Any way to add icons to the app bundle for older macOS versions?
Several app developers are struggling with the inability to provide a separate app icons that looks nice on older macOS versions while at the same time provide Icon Composer icons that look great on macOS Tahoe 26. An ability to provide separate icons is super important to those who have app icons that follow the curvature of the default icon borders (as the corner rounding radius is different for Sequia and Tahoe). Take a look at this for example: https://github.com/ghostty-org/ghostty/issues/7564#issuecomment-3042061547 Question: Is there a definitive/recommended way to address this issue? How can a developer add a glass icon variant that looks good on Tahoe and provide a bitmap icon for older macOS versions? Some background info: Prior to Xcode 26 beta 4, one could add an App Icon to Assets to be used as app icon for legacy macOS versions (Sequia and older) and use a new Icon Composer icon (placed in the project root) for macOS Tahoe 26. Enabling "Include all app icon assets" under target settings ensured that older macOS versions would use the old app icons while Tahoe the new Icon Composer glass one. Since Xcode beta 4 this technique no longer works. Xcode instead insists on populating Assets.car with Icon Composer generated variants, disregarding the App Icon provided in Assets. Although the App Icon in Assets makes its way to a .incs file in the app bundle's Contents/Resources folder, but that is not used by macOS anymore and is there for some compatibility purposes. The Assets.car file (which matters) only contains the variants generated by Icon Composer and does not contain the png icons provided in the Assets.

Local Network permission appears to be ignored after reboot, even though it was granted
We have a Java application built for macOS. On the first launch, the application prompts the user to allow local network access. We've correctly added the NSLocalNetworkUsageDescription key to the Info.plist, and the provided description appears in the system prompt. After the user grants permission, the application can successfully connect to a local server using its hostname. However, the issue arises after the system is rebooted. When the application is launched again, macOS does not prompt for local network access a second time—which is expected, as the permission was already granted. Despite this, the application is unable to connect to the local server. It appears the previously granted permission is being ignored after a reboot. A temporary workaround is to manually toggle the Local Network permission off and back on via System Settings &gt; Privacy &amp; Security, which restores connectivity—until the next reboot. This behavior is highly disruptive, both for us and for a significant number of our users. We can reproduce this on multiple systems... The issues started from macOS Sequoia 15.0 By opening the application bundle using "Show Package Contents," we can launch the application via "JavaAppLauncher" without any issues. Once started, the application is able to connect to our server over the local network. This seems to bypass the granted permissions? "JavaAppLauncher" is also been used in our Info.plist file

DEXT (IOUserSCSIParallelInterfaceController): Direct I/O Succeeds, but Buffered I/O Fails with Data Corruption on Large File Copies
Hi all, We are migrating a SCSI HBA driver from KEXT to DriverKit (DEXT), with our DEXT inheriting from IOUserSCSIParallelInterfaceController. We've encountered a data corruption issue that is reliably reproducible under specific conditions and are hoping for some assistance from the community. Hardware and Driver Configuration: Controller: LSI 3108 DEXT Configuration: We are reporting our hardware limitations to the framework via the UserReportHBAConstraints function, with the following key settings: // UserReportHBAConstraints... addConstraint(kIOMaximumSegmentAddressableBitCountKey, 0x20); // 32-bit addConstraint(kIOMaximumSegmentCountWriteKey, 129); addConstraint(kIOMaximumByteCountWriteKey, 0x80000); // 512KB Observed Behavior: Direct I/O vs. Buffered I/O We've observed that the I/O behavior differs drastically depending on whether it goes through the system file cache: 1. Direct I/O (Bypassing System Cache) -> 100% Successful When we use fio with the direct=1 flag, our read/write and data verification tests pass perfectly for all file sizes, including 20GB+. 2. Buffered I/O (Using System Cache) -> 100% Failure at >128MB Whether we use the standard cp command or fio with the direct=1 option removed to simulate buffered I/O, we observe the exact same, clear failure threshold: Test Results: File sizes ≤ 128MB: Success. Data checksums match perfectly. File sizes ≥ 256MB: Failure. Checksums do not match, and the destination file is corrupted. Evidence of failure reproduced with fio (buffered_integrity_test.fio, with direct=1 removed): fio --size=128M buffered_integrity_test.fio -> Test Succeeded (err=0). fio --size=256M buffered_integrity_test.fio -> Test Failed (err=92), reporting the following error, which proves a data mismatch during the verification phase: verify: bad header ... at file ... offset 1048576, length 1048576 fio: ... error=Illegal byte sequence Our Analysis and Hypothesis The phenomenon of "Direct I/O succeeding while Buffered I/O fails" suggests the problem may be related to the cache synchronization mechanism at the end of the I/O process: Our UserProcessParallelTask_Impl function correctly handles READ and WRITE commands. When cp or fio (buffered) runs, the WRITE commands are successfully written to the LSI 3108 controller's onboard DRAM cache, and success is reported up the stack. At the end of the operation, to ensure data is flushed to disk, the macOS file system issues an fsync, which is ultimately translated into a SYNCHRONIZE CACHE SCSI command (Opcode 0x35 or 0x91) and sent to our UserProcessParallelTask_Impl. We hypothesize that our code may not be correctly identifying or handling this SYNCHRONIZE CACHE opcode. It might be reporting "success" up the stack without actually commanding the hardware to flush its cache to the physical disk. The OS receives this "success" status and assumes the operation is safely complete. In reality, however, the last batch of data remains only in the controller's volatile DRAM cache and is eventually lost. This results in an incomplete or incorrect file tail, and while the file size may be correct, the data checksum will inevitably fail. Summary Our DEXT driver performs correctly when handling Direct I/O but consistently fails with data corruption when handling Buffered I/O for files larger than 128MB. We can reliably reproduce this issue using fio with the direct=1 option removed. The root cause is very likely the improper handling of the SYNCHRONIZE CACHE command within our UserProcessParallelTask. P.S. This issue did not exist in the original KEXT version of the driver. We would appreciate any advice or guidance on this issue. Thank you.
